const http = require('http'); const http = require('https'); const fs = require('fs'); const express = require('express') const app = express(); const bodyParser = require('body-parser') // app.use(bodyParser.urlencoded({ extended: false })) // app.use(bodyParser.json()) const request = require('ajax-request'); // app.use(express.static('vcm')); // app.listen(process.env.PORT || 8083); // const app = express(); // Certificate const privateKey = fs.readFileSync('/etc/letsencrypt/live/umfrage.smartvillages.online/privkey.pem', 'utf8'); const certificate = fs.readFileSync('/etc/letsencrypt/live/umfrage.smartvillages.online/cert.pem', 'utf8'); const ca = fs.readFileSync('/etc/letsencrypt/live/umfrage.smartvillages.online/chain.pem', 'utf8'); const credentials = { key: privateKey, cert: certificate, ca: ca }; app.use(express.static(__dirname, { dotfiles: 'allow' } )); // Starting both http & https servers const httpServer = http.createServer(app); const httpsServer = https.createServer(credentials, app); httpServer.listen(8084, () => { console.log('HTTP Server running on port 80'); }); httpsServer.listen(8083, () => { console.log('HTTPS Server running on port 8083'); }); // app.post('/addpoint', function(req,res){ // try { // const data = req.body; // console.log("data ==============") // console.log(data.id); // args.gmlid = data.id // console.log(data[0]); // console.log(data[1]); // console.log("args ==============") // console.log(args); // } // catch (err) { // console.log('.../getSimS failed!\n' + err); // } // });